这里是文章模块栏目内容页
mysql备份关系修复(mysql备份和恢复数据库命令)

导读:MySQL备份和关系修复是数据库管理中非常重要的一部分,它们可以保证数据的安全性和可靠性。本文将介绍如何进行MySQL备份与关系修复,并提供一些实用的技巧和注意事项。

1. MySQL备份

备份是防止数据丢失的最好方式之一。在MySQL中,我们可以使用以下命令进行备份:

- mysqldump:将整个数据库备份到一个文件中

- mysqlhotcopy:备份InnoDB和MyISAM表

- LVM快照:创建LVM快照并备份数据

此外,我们还可以使用工具如XtraBackup、Percona等来进行备份。无论使用哪种备份方法,都需要定期进行备份以确保数据的安全性。

2. MySQL关系修复

当MySQL出现问题时,可能会导致表之间的关系被破坏。这时候,我们需要进行关系修复来恢复数据的完整性。以下是一些常见的关系修复方法:

- CHECK TABLE:检查表是否有损坏并尝试修复它

- REPAIR TABLE:尝试修复已损坏的表

- OPTIMIZE TABLE:优化表并尝试修复已损坏的表

需要注意的是,在进行关系修复之前,我们应该先进行备份以避免数据丢失。

总结:MySQL备份和关系修复是数据库管理中非常重要的一部分,它们可以保证数据的安全性和可靠性。无论是备份还是关系修复,我们都需要定期进行并注意备份的方式和关系修复的方法。